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Siem Reap, Cambodia

Angkor Wat

Angkor Wat, the iconic temple complex, needs no introduction. Witness the breathtaking sunrise over its towering spires – a moment etched in the memories of countless travelers. Explore its intricate carvings, vast courtyards, and hidden chambers, feeling the weight of history beneath your feet.

Angkor Thom

Within the sprawling walls of Angkor Thom lies a city of temples, including the enigmatic Bayon with its smiling faces and the atmospheric Ta Prohm, where ancient stone is entwined with the roots of giant trees – a truly magical sight.

Banteay Srei

Known as the "Citadel of Women," Banteay Srei is a smaller but exquisitely detailed temple, renowned for its intricate pink sandstone carvings. Its delicate beauty is a testament to the artistry of the Khmer civilization.

Best Zones & Areas to Explore in Siem Reap, Cambodia

  • Pub Street: The heart of Siem Reap's nightlife, with a lively atmosphere and numerous bars and restaurants.
  • Old Market (Psar Chas): A bustling market offering a wide array of souvenirs, clothing, and local crafts.
  • Wat Bo Village: A peaceful area with a beautiful temple and charming local shops.
  • The Angkor Archaeological Park: Home to the magnificent temples of Angkor, requiring multiple days to explore fully.

Eat Like a Local: Must-Try Foods in Siem Reap, Cambodia

  • Amok: A creamy fish curry, a true Cambodian classic.
  • Lok Lak: Stir-fried beef with a flavorful sauce, served with rice.
  • Nom Banh Chok: A delicious noodle soup, a national dish.
  • Fresh Spring Rolls: Light and refreshing, perfect for a hot day.

Venture beyond the tourist restaurants and explore local eateries for an authentic culinary experience.

Best Time to Visit Siem Reap, Cambodia

The dry season (November to April) offers the best weather for exploring the temples. However, this is also the peak tourist season. The shoulder seasons (May and October) offer a pleasant climate with fewer crowds.
